    The Missouri Public Defender System (MSPD) is dedicated to providing legal representation to individuals accused of or convicted of crimes in Missouri who cannot afford an attorney. MSPD operates statewide through district offices strategically located throughout the state, offering opportunities to work in diverse settings, from urban areas like Kansas City and St. Louis to more rural environments. We are seeking mitigation specialists to help our clients with the underlying issues that have led to their contact with the criminal legal system. By connecting clients to community resources and working with attorneys to advocate for holistic outcomes, mitigation specialists play a critical role in reducing pretrial detention and unnecessary prison sentences, ultimately creating lasting change in the criminal legal system.

    As a Mitigation Specialist, you will serve clients in an assigned region, building relationships with community providers and overcoming barriers clients face in accessing services and the stigma of criminal legal involvement. Your key responsibilities include:

      • Client Advocacy and Case Management:
        • Work with clients to identify and achieve service goals.
        • Provide case management services to clients.
        • Conduct psychosocial history interviews with clients.
        • Develop mitigation memoranda for use in clients’ cases.
      • Research and Investigation:
        • Request and review records.
        • Conduct literature reviews and social science research as part of mitigation work.
        • Identify and interview mitigation witnesses.
      • Collaboration and Communication:
        • Develop mitigation themes and evidence in collaboration with attorneys and other members of the defense team.
        • Draft formal and informal mitigation memoranda.
        • Engage with community organizations to increase access to services for clients.
        • Provide support and guidance to Holistic Defense Advocates in your assigned region.
      • Supervision and Training:
        • Supervise social work interns and other holistic defense interns.
        • Help collect and analyze data tracking holistic defense work and its impact.
